Use a solution with 2% salacylic acid and apply with a pad or cotton ball. It will sting a bit. Keep away from the eyes. This should be used after washing with a soap that will open the pores. You should always wash before using this solution and try it up to 2 times a day. You will need to continue using it, but should see results within a week or two.
